Decoding Orcish Naming Conventions

Creating an authentic name requires understanding the universe you are playing in. D&D 5e races handle naming differently than the Elder Scrolls universe.

Skyrim and The Elder Scrolls

In Tamriel, Orcs (Orsimer) have strict rules. A female orc name generator for Skyrim must include the prefix "gra-" before the mother's name (e.g., Ghorza gra-Bagol). Males use "gro-" before the father's name.

Dungeons & Dragons and Pathfinder

A pathfinder orc name generator focuses on guttural sounds that reflect Gruumsh lore. Names often lack surnames unless the Orc has earned an epithet like "Elf-Slayer." A half orc name generator dnd often produces names that sound slightly softer, reflecting their human heritage, or they might adopt a human name entirely if raised in a city.

Creating Clan and Tribe Names

Sometimes the individual name isn't enough. You need an orc clan name generator logic to build a backstory.

  • The Action-Object Method: Combine a violent verb with a body part (e.g., Skullsmash, Ribbreaker).
  • The Element Method: Mix a weapon type with a natural element (e.g., Ironhide, Bloodaxe).
  • The Shadow of War Style: A shadow of war orc generator often uses titles based on personality, like "The Tark Slayer" or "The Glutton."

Frequently Asked Questions

How do Skyrim Orc names work?

Skyrim Orcs (Orsimer) use a matronymic or patronymic surname system. Males use "gro-[Father's Name]" and females use "gra-[Mother's Name]." This connects them directly to their lineage and orc tribe names.

Do Orcs have last names?

In most fantasy character creation settings like D&D, Orcs do not have family names. Instead, they earn epithets based on deeds (e.g., "Bone-Snapper") or use their clan name to identify allegiance.

What is a good name for a Half-Orc?

Good Half-Orc names bridge two worlds. You might choose a human first name with an Orcish surname, or a sharp Orcish name like "Zar" or "Grom" to emphasize their strength. RPG name generators often blend these styles.

What language do Orcs speak?

In D&D, they speak Orcish, a language known for hard consonants. In LOTR, they use variants of the Black Speech. Knowing the Tolkien orcish language helps in crafting names that sound genuinely threatening.
